A man splashed out £500 to win a bidding war for Manchester United tickets at a charity auction - then set them on fire after collecting them on stage.
He's believed to be a Leeds United supporter - and his stunt was filmed in footage that has now gone viral on social media.
The winning bidder, who hasn't been identified, was attending a charity ball held in memory of Leeds mum-of-two Sharon Witcher, who passed away two years ago from cancer, to raise money for St Gemma's Hospice in Leeds.

Bids for the corporate hospitality tickets for Old Trafford were struggling to get past the £100 mark, until the man's single bid pushed it up to £500, albeit on the promise he could burn them if he won.
In the video, the Leeds fan can be seen taking a lighter to the corner of the tickets before they go up in flames. He then places the tickets into a bucket that he raises up to show the packed hall, prompting football chants and cheering from the Leeds-based audience.
Danny Waite, 32, posted the video to Twitter where it swiftly went viral and racked up more than 2,200 likes and 620,000 views.
Danny, from Leeds, said: "It was a good night. That was one of the auction prizes, two tickets to Manchester United Corporate Hospitality Experience.
"So the Leeds fan bought it and just set fire to it. I know he loves a lot of Leeds games, he's a big fan. There weren't many [United fans] bidding on them.
"There were two bids previously at like £50 and then £100. It was stuck at £100 for quite a while and then he shouted out £500, and said 'I'll give you £500 to burn them'.
